WebIt is important to note that traditional exercise, whilst important, is not the only solution available to people with lung disease. Many benefit physically and emotionally from taking part in singing groups. Singing is a great exercise that helps the patient to regulate their breathing and helps them deal with breathlessness. WebA regular exercise routine can help improve a COPD patient’s strength and help reduce the feeling of breathlessness. For some patients in the later stages of COPD, oxygen therapy can help decrease shortness of breath.
